This unit will:<br/>- provide an understanding of the theoretical framework of psychoacoustics underlying hearing threshold, hearing loss and related audiometric concepts;<br/>- equip students with skills required to perform standard audiometric assessments of adults and older children, including otoscopy, pure tone audiometry, speech discrimination testing, clinical masking, and acoustic immittance; and<br/>- facilitate the development of problem-solving and clinical integration skills for interpretation of audiological information, appropriate clinical decision making and referral. -- Course Website
